How to use BDO PRIVATE BANK INC. SWIFT Code?

The SWIFT code BOPBPHMM is essential for international transactions involving BDO PRIVATE BANK INC.. When someone sends you money from another country, they will ask for this BIC (Business Identifier Code).

International Wire Transfer Instructions

Provide these details to the remitting party:

  • Beneficiary Name: Your full name as per bank records.
  • Account Number: Your IBAN or Account Number.
  • SWIFT/BIC Code: BOPBPHMM
  • Bank Name & Branch: BDO PRIVATE BANK INC., CITY OF MAKATI branch.
